Gradient-based Design of Computational Granular Crystals

Read original: arXiv:2404.04825 - Published 4/9/2024 by Atoosa Parsa, Corey S. O'Hern, Rebecca Kramer-Bottiglio, Josh Bongard
Total Score

0

Gradient-based Design of Computational Granular Crystals

Sign in to get full access

or

If you already have an account, we'll log you in

Overview

  • This paper introduces a differentiable simulator for training reinforcement learning agents in complex environments.
  • The key ideas include a differentiable physics engine, a learned dynamics model, and a technique for efficient gradient estimation.
  • The authors demonstrate the effectiveness of their approach on various robotic control tasks.

Plain English Explanation

In this paper, the researchers developed a new way to train artificial intelligence (AI) systems, specifically for robotic control tasks. The core idea is to create a "differentiable simulator" - a virtual environment that can be used to train the AI, but one that is designed in a way that allows the training process to be more efficient and effective.

The differentiable simulator has a few key components:

  1. A differentiable physics engine that can accurately model the physical interactions in the virtual environment.
  2. A learned dynamics model that can predict how the environment will change over time.
  3. A technique for efficiently estimating the gradients needed to train the AI system.

By using this differentiable simulator, the researchers were able to train AI agents to perform various robotic control tasks more effectively than previous methods. The key advantage is that the differentiable nature of the simulator allows the training process to be more efficient and better-guided, leading to faster and more reliable learning.

Technical Explanation

The core innovation in this paper is the development of a differentiable simulator for training reinforcement learning agents. The key components of this simulator include:

  1. Differentiable Physics Engine: The authors designed a physics engine that can accurately model the physical interactions in the environment, but crucially, this engine is differentiable. This means that the gradients of the physical simulation with respect to the agent's actions can be efficiently computed.

  2. Learned Dynamics Model: In addition to the physics engine, the authors also learned a dynamics model that can predict how the environment will evolve over time. This learned model is also differentiable, allowing gradients to be efficiently computed.

  3. Efficient Gradient Estimation: To enable effective training of the reinforcement learning agent, the authors developed a technique for efficiently estimating the gradients needed to update the agent's policy. This involves a combination of techniques from variational inference and automatic differentiation.

The authors demonstrate the effectiveness of their approach on a variety of robotic control tasks, showing that the differentiable simulator leads to faster and more reliable learning compared to previous methods.

Critical Analysis

The key strengths of this research are the novel technical contributions, such as the differentiable physics engine and efficient gradient estimation techniques. These innovations represent significant advancements in the field of reinforcement learning and could have widespread implications for training AI systems, especially in complex, physically-grounded environments.

However, the paper also acknowledges several limitations and areas for future work. For example, the authors note that the differentiable simulator may not be able to capture all the nuances of real-world physical interactions, and that further research is needed to bridge the gap between simulation and reality. Additionally, the computational complexity of the differentiable simulator could be a challenge for scaling to very large and complex environments.

Another potential concern is the reliance on a learned dynamics model, which could introduce biases or inaccuracies that could negatively impact the training process. The authors briefly mention the need for further research into improving the robustness and reliability of these learned models.

Overall, this research represents an important step forward in the field of reinforcement learning and the development of more effective and efficient training techniques for AI systems. However, as with any cutting-edge research, there are still challenges and open questions that will need to be addressed in future work.

Conclusion

This paper introduces a novel approach to training reinforcement learning agents using a differentiable simulator. By incorporating a differentiable physics engine, a learned dynamics model, and efficient gradient estimation techniques, the authors have developed a powerful tool for training AI systems, particularly in complex, physically-grounded environments.

The key contributions of this research include advancements in differentiable simulation, learned dynamics modeling, and gradient estimation. These innovations have the potential to significantly improve the efficiency and effectiveness of reinforcement learning in a wide range of applications, from robotics to brain-inspired neuromorphic computing.

While the paper highlights several promising results, it also acknowledges the need for further research to address the limitations of the current approach, such as the gap between simulation and reality, the computational complexity of the differentiable simulator, and the robustness of the learned dynamics model. Continued advancements in these areas could lead to even more powerful and versatile training techniques for AI systems.



This summary was produced with help from an AI and may contain inaccuracies - check out the links to read the original source documents!

Follow @aimodelsfyi on 𝕏 →

Related Papers

Gradient-based Design of Computational Granular Crystals
Total Score

0

Gradient-based Design of Computational Granular Crystals

Atoosa Parsa, Corey S. O'Hern, Rebecca Kramer-Bottiglio, Josh Bongard

There is growing interest in engineering unconventional computing devices that leverage the intrinsic dynamics of physical substrates to perform fast and energy-efficient computations. Granular metamaterials are one such substrate that has emerged as a promising platform for building wave-based information processing devices with the potential to integrate sensing, actuation, and computation. Their high-dimensional and nonlinear dynamics result in nontrivial and sometimes counter-intuitive wave responses that can be shaped by the material properties, geometry, and configuration of individual grains. Such highly tunable rich dynamics can be utilized for mechanical computing in special-purpose applications. However, there are currently no general frameworks for the inverse design of large-scale granular materials. Here, we build upon the similarity between the spatiotemporal dynamics of wave propagation in material and the computational dynamics of Recurrent Neural Networks to develop a gradient-based optimization framework for harmonically driven granular crystals. We showcase how our framework can be utilized to design basic logic gates where mechanical vibrations carry the information at predetermined frequencies. We compare our design methodology with classic gradient-free methods and find that our approach discovers higher-performing configurations with less computational effort. Our findings show that a gradient-based optimization method can greatly expand the design space of metamaterials and provide the opportunity to systematically traverse the parameter space to find materials with the desired functionalities.

Read more

4/9/2024

Guided Diffusion for Fast Inverse Design of Density-based Mechanical Metamaterials
Total Score

0

Guided Diffusion for Fast Inverse Design of Density-based Mechanical Metamaterials

Yanyan Yang, Lili Wang, Xiaoya Zhai, Kai Chen, Wenming Wu, Yunkai Zhao, Ligang Liu, Xiao-Ming Fu

Mechanical metamaterial is a synthetic material that can possess extraordinary physical characteristics, such as abnormal elasticity, stiffness, and stability, by carefully designing its internal structure. To make metamaterials contain delicate local structures with unique mechanical properties, it is a potential method to represent them through high-resolution voxels. However, it brings a substantial computational burden. To this end, this paper proposes a fast inverse design method, whose core is an advanced deep generative AI algorithm, to generate voxel-based mechanical metamaterials. Specifically, we use the self-conditioned diffusion model, capable of generating a microstructure with a resolution of $128^3$ to approach the specified homogenized tensor matrix in just 3 seconds. Accordingly, this rapid reverse design tool facilitates the exploration of extreme metamaterials, the sequence interpolation in metamaterials, and the generation of diverse microstructures for multi-scale design. This flexible and adaptive generative tool is of great value in structural engineering or other mechanical systems and can stimulate more subsequent research.

Read more

6/11/2024

An Uncertainty-aware Deep Learning Framework-based Robust Design Optimization of Metamaterial Units
Total Score

0

An Uncertainty-aware Deep Learning Framework-based Robust Design Optimization of Metamaterial Units

Zihan Wang, Anindya Bhaduri, Hongyi Xu, Liping Wang

Mechanical metamaterials represent an innovative class of artificial structures, distinguished by their extraordinary mechanical characteristics, which are beyond the scope of traditional natural materials. The use of deep generative models has become increasingly popular in the design of metamaterial units. The effectiveness of using deep generative models lies in their capacity to compress complex input data into a simplified, lower-dimensional latent space, while also enabling the creation of novel optimal designs through sampling within this space. However, the design process does not take into account the effect of model uncertainty due to data sparsity or the effect of input data uncertainty due to inherent randomness in the data. This might lead to the generation of undesirable structures with high sensitivity to the uncertainties in the system. To address this issue, a novel uncertainty-aware deep learning framework-based robust design approach is proposed for the design of metamaterial units with optimal target properties. The proposed approach utilizes the probabilistic nature of the deep learning framework and quantifies both aleatoric and epistemic uncertainties associated with surrogate-based design optimization. We demonstrate that the proposed design approach is capable of designing high-performance metamaterial units with high reliability. To showcase the effectiveness of the proposed design approach, a single-objective design optimization problem and a multi-objective design optimization problem are presented. The optimal robust designs obtained are validated by comparing them to the designs obtained from the topology optimization method as well as the designs obtained from a deterministic deep learning framework-based design optimization where none of the uncertainties in the system are explicitly considered.

Read more

7/31/2024

📊

Total Score

0

Inverse designing metamaterials with programmable nonlinear functional responses in graph space

Marco Maurizi, Derek Xu, Yu-Tong Wang, Desheng Yao, David Hahn, Mourad Oudich, Anish Satpati, Mathieu Bauchy, Wei Wang, Yizhou Sun, Yun Jing, Xiaoyu Rayne Zheng

Material responses to static and dynamic stimuli, represented as nonlinear curves, are design targets for engineering functionalities like structural support, impact protection, and acoustic and photonic bandgaps. Three-dimensional metamaterials offer significant tunability due to their internal structure, yet existing methods struggle to capture their complex behavior-to-structure relationships. We present GraphMetaMat, a graph-based framework capable of designing three-dimensional metamaterials with programmable responses and arbitrary manufacturing constraints. Integrating graph networks, physics biases, reinforcement learning, and tree search, GraphMetaMat can target stress-strain curves spanning four orders of magnitude and complex behaviors, as well as viscoelastic transmission responses with varying attenuation gaps. GraphMetaMat can create cushioning materials for protective equipment and vibration-damping panels for electric vehicles, outperforming commercial materials, and enabling the automatic design of materials with on-demand functionalities.

Read more

8/13/2024